What Are Goose Down Pillows Made From?
Goose down pillows are made from the soft undercoating of geese and come in various types and qualities.
- Goose Down: This is the primary material used in goose down pillows, consisting of the fluffy clusters found beneath the feathers of geese. Goose down is known for its superior insulation and lightweight properties, making pillows filled with it incredibly soft and comfortable.
- Feather Fill: Often blended with down, feather fill comes from the outer feathers of geese and ducks. While not as soft as down, it provides added support and durability to the pillow, making it an economical choice for those who want a balance of comfort and firmness.
- Shell Fabric: The outer covering of goose down pillows is typically made from cotton or a cotton blend, which is breathable and helps to contain the down fill. High-thread-count fabrics are often used for a luxurious feel and to prevent the down from escaping.
- Fill Power: This refers to the quality of the down used in the pillow, measured by how much space one ounce of down occupies in cubic inches. Higher fill power indicates better insulation and loft, resulting in a pillow that is fluffier and warmer.
- Allergen-Resistant Treatments: Some goose down pillows undergo special treatments to reduce allergens and make them more suitable for sensitive individuals. These treatments can help eliminate dust mites and other allergens, ensuring a healthier sleep environment.

How Does Goose Down Compare to Synthetic Fillings?
| Aspect | Goose Down | Synthetic Fillings |
|---|---|---|
| Insulation | Excellent insulation properties, retains heat effectively. | Good insulation, but may not retain heat as well as down. |
| Weight | Lightweight and compressible, making it easy to pack. | Generally heavier and bulkier than down options. |
| Cost | Typically more expensive due to sourcing and processing. | More affordable, widely available in various price ranges. |
| Care | Requires special cleaning; can be damaged by moisture. | Easy to wash and dry, often machine washable. |
| Durability | Can last for many years with proper care, but may lose loft over time. | Generally durable and retains shape well, but may degrade faster than down. |
| Hypoallergenic properties | May cause allergies in some individuals, though hypoallergenic options are available. | Typically hypoallergenic, making them suitable for allergy sufferers. |
| Environmental impact | Sourcing can raise animal welfare concerns; however, responsibly sourced options exist. | Often made from petroleum-based products, raising environmental concerns regarding sustainability. |

What Factors Should You Consider When Choosing a Goose Down Pillow?
When choosing the best pillow goose down, several key factors should be considered to ensure comfort and support.
- Fill Power: Fill power measures the loft and insulating ability of the down. A higher fill power indicates a greater quality down with more volume, providing better warmth and support while remaining lightweight.
- Fill Weight: This refers to the amount of down used in the pillow. A pillow with a higher fill weight will generally offer more support and firmness, making it ideal for those who prefer a more elevated sleeping position.
- Construction: The pillow’s construction affects its durability and comfort. Look for options with baffle box designs that prevent the down from shifting and ensure even distribution, as well as double-stitching to reduce the risk of down leakage.
- Shell Material: The fabric covering the pillow is crucial for comfort and breathability. High thread count cotton or cotton blends are often preferred as they are soft to the touch and allow for better airflow, enhancing the overall sleeping experience.
- Allergies: If you have allergies, consider hypoallergenic options that are specially treated to resist allergens. Some goose down pillows are labeled hypoallergenic, which can provide peace of mind without sacrificing comfort.
- Maintenance: Check the care instructions to understand how easy it is to clean the pillow. Some goose down pillows are machine washable, while others may require dry cleaning, which can affect long-term usability and convenience.
- Price: The price can vary significantly based on the quality of the down and the materials used. Investing in a higher-quality goose down pillow may be more cost-effective in the long run due to its durability and comfort, compared to cheaper alternatives that may not provide the same level of support.
How Important Is Fill Power in Determining Pillow Quality?
Fill power is a crucial factor in determining the quality of goose down pillows, as it measures the loft and insulation capabilities of the down filling.
- Definition of Fill Power: Fill power is defined as the volume in cubic inches that one ounce of down occupies. A higher fill power indicates a greater ability to trap air and provide insulation.
- Quality Indicator: The fill power rating often ranges from 400 to 800 or more, with higher numbers typically signifying superior quality. This means that pillows with higher fill power can offer better warmth and comfort while being lighter in weight.
- Durability and Longevity: Pillows with high fill power tend to maintain their shape and loft for a longer period, providing sustained support over time. This durability is essential for ensuring that the pillow continues to provide comfort and insulation throughout its lifespan.
- Comfort Level: The fill power directly impacts the comfort of the pillow, as higher fill power allows for better cushioning and support for the head and neck. This is particularly important for individuals who seek a plush yet supportive sleeping surface.
- Temperature Regulation: High fill power goose down pillows are more efficient in regulating temperature due to their superior insulation properties. This helps in keeping the sleeper warm during colder months while also allowing for breathability during warmer periods.

How Do You Properly Care for Goose Down Pillows to Ensure Longevity?
To properly care for goose down pillows and ensure their longevity, consider the following practices:
- Regular Fluffing: Fluff your goose down pillows daily to maintain their shape and loft. This helps to redistribute the down clusters and prevent clumping, keeping the pillow comfortable and supportive.
- Use a Pillow Protector: Invest in a breathable pillow protector to shield the pillow from dust mites, moisture, and stains. This not only extends the life of the pillow but also keeps it clean and hygienic.
- Washing Instructions: Follow specific washing guidelines, typically using a front-loading washer on a gentle cycle with mild detergent. Avoid using bleach or fabric softeners and ensure the pillow is thoroughly dried to prevent mold and mildew.
- Avoid Excessive Heat: When drying down pillows, use a low heat setting and add dryer balls to help fluff the down. High heat can damage the down clusters and lead to a loss of insulation and comfort.
- Storage Practices: Store goose down pillows in a cool, dry place when not in use, preferably in a breathable cotton bag. Avoid compressing them for extended periods, as this can damage the down and reduce its loft.
